Unlocking BTC Market Approaches for Maximum Gains
Navigating the unpredictable world of BTC trading requires more than just luck; it demands a carefully considered strategy. While no system guarantees reliable success, several common approaches can significantly improve your potential of generating robust earnings. Explore dollar-cost averaging, which involves regularly investing a predetermined amount regardless of market fluctuations, smoothing out the impact of volatility. Alternatively, day trading – a high-risk, high-reward strategy – might appeal to more skilled traders, but demands substantial research and rapid decision-making. Moreover, employing technical analysis – studying chart patterns and data – can help identify favorable purchase and selling points. Note that responsible investing always includes detailed research, risk management, and comprehending the underlying asset.

Navigating the copyright Trading Environment: Risks & Rewards
The world of copyright markets presents a compelling yet complex chance for participants. Although the potential for significant profits is a major draw, it's crucial to acknowledge the inherent risks involved. Volatility is a defining characteristic; prices can experience sharp increases and downturns, often driven by investor sentiment and legal developments. Moreover, the absence of control in many jurisdictions exposes traders to possible scams, deception, and protection breaches. Achievement in this space requires a disciplined approach, thorough research, and a grounded understanding of your own risk tolerance. In conclusion, informed participation is essential to maximizing potential gains while reducing likely drawbacks.
